怕数据库是什么

worktile 其他 46

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库是一种用于存储和管理数据的软件系统。它是组织和存储数据的集合,可以通过各种查询和操作来访问和处理数据。数据库可以用于存储各种类型的数据,包括文本、数字、图像、音频和视频等。它是许多应用程序的核心,用于存储和检索数据,以支持各种业务需求。

    数据库具有以下几个重要的特点:

    1. 数据组织:数据库使用表格的形式来组织数据,每个表格包含一组相关的数据项。表格由行和列组成,行表示记录,列表示数据项。通过这种结构化的方式,数据库可以更方便地存储和管理大量的数据。

    2. 数据一致性:数据库通过强制一致性约束来确保数据的完整性和一致性。例如,可以定义主键、外键和唯一约束等来限制数据的输入和更新,以避免数据的冗余和不一致。

    3. 数据安全性:数据库提供了各种安全机制来保护数据的安全性,包括用户认证、访问控制和数据加密等。只有经过授权的用户才能访问和修改数据库中的数据,以防止未经授权的访问和数据泄露。

    4. 数据并发性:数据库支持多用户同时访问和操作数据的能力,称为并发性。通过使用锁机制和事务管理,数据库可以确保多个用户之间的数据访问和操作不会相互干扰,从而实现高效的并发处理。

    5. 数据备份和恢复:数据库提供了备份和恢复功能,可以定期备份数据,并在意外故障或数据丢失时恢复数据。这样可以保证数据的可靠性和可恢复性,防止数据的丢失和损坏。

    总之,数据库是一种重要的数据管理工具,它可以帮助组织和管理大量的数据,并提供高效、安全和可靠的数据访问和处理功能。在现代信息化时代,数据库在各个领域都有广泛的应用,为企业和个人提供了强大的数据支持。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库是一种用于存储和管理数据的软件系统。它可以提供数据的组织、存储、检索和更新等功能。数据库可以是以文件形式存储的,也可以是以服务器形式运行的。它可以用于各种应用领域,如企业管理、电子商务、金融服务等。

    1. 数据存储和管理:数据库可以存储大量的数据,并提供高效的数据管理机制。它可以将数据组织成表格的形式,每个表格包含多个列和行,每个列对应一种数据类型,每个行对应一个数据记录。通过数据库,用户可以方便地插入、更新、删除和查询数据。

    2. 数据共享和协作:数据库可以提供多用户共享数据的功能。多个用户可以同时访问数据库,并进行数据的读写操作。数据库可以管理用户的访问权限,确保只有授权用户才能访问和修改数据。这样可以实现团队协作和信息共享,提高工作效率。

    3. 数据一致性和完整性:数据库可以保证数据的一致性和完整性。一致性指的是数据在不同的地方或时间点的表现应该是一致的。完整性指的是数据应该满足事先定义的约束条件,如主键约束、唯一约束、外键约束等。数据库可以通过事务管理和约束条件来保证数据的一致性和完整性。

    4. 数据安全和备份恢复:数据库可以提供数据的安全保护机制。它可以管理用户的访问权限,防止未经授权的访问和修改数据。同时,数据库也可以进行数据备份和恢复,以防止数据丢失和损坏。备份可以将数据库的数据和结构保存到外部存储介质,恢复可以将备份的数据和结构重新导入到数据库中。

    5. 数据处理和分析:数据库可以提供强大的数据处理和分析功能。它支持各种查询语言和数据分析工具,可以进行复杂的数据查询和分析操作。数据库还可以支持事务处理、并发控制、索引优化等技术,提高数据处理和查询的效率。

    总之,数据库是一种非常重要的数据管理工具,它可以帮助组织和管理大量的数据,并提供数据共享、一致性、安全性和分析等功能。对于企业和个人来说,掌握数据库的使用和管理技术是非常有价值的。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库是指存储和管理数据的系统,它可以用来存储和组织大量的数据,以便于后续的数据检索、更新和管理。数据库可以分为关系型数据库和非关系型数据库两种类型。

    关系型数据库使用表格来组织数据,表格由行和列组成,每一行代表一个记录,每一列代表一个字段。关系型数据库使用结构化查询语言(SQL)来操作和管理数据。常见的关系型数据库有MySQL、Oracle和SQL Server等。

    非关系型数据库则以其他形式来组织和存储数据,比如键值对、文档、图形等。非关系型数据库通常更适用于大数据和高并发访问的场景。常见的非关系型数据库有MongoDB、Redis和Cassandra等。

    数据库的作用非常广泛,它可以用于存储和管理各种类型的数据,包括用户信息、产品信息、订单信息、日志信息等。数据库可以提供高效的数据访问和查询功能,能够快速地检索和获取需要的数据。同时,数据库还可以提供数据的安全性和可靠性,通过数据备份和恢复功能,保证数据的完整性和可恢复性。

    为了使用数据库,我们需要进行一系列的操作和管理。下面是一个常见的数据库操作流程:

    1. 设计数据库结构:根据业务需求,设计数据库的表格和字段结构。这需要考虑数据之间的关系和依赖,以及数据的类型和约束。

    2. 创建数据库:在数据库管理系统中创建一个新的数据库。这个过程通常由管理员完成,可以使用SQL命令或者图形化界面工具来创建数据库。

    3. 创建表格:在数据库中创建表格,定义表格的字段和属性。表格的字段应该和设计阶段确定的数据结构一致,可以指定字段的类型、长度、约束等。

    4. 插入数据:将数据插入到数据库中的表格中。可以使用SQL的INSERT语句来插入数据,也可以使用图形化界面工具来操作。

    5. 查询数据:使用SQL的SELECT语句来查询数据库中的数据。可以根据条件过滤数据,排序数据,统计数据等。

    6. 更新数据:使用SQL的UPDATE语句来更新数据库中的数据。可以修改单个字段的值,也可以修改多个字段。

    7. 删除数据:使用SQL的DELETE语句来删除数据库中的数据。可以根据条件删除数据,也可以删除整个表格中的数据。

    8. 管理数据库:进行数据库的管理工作,包括备份和恢复数据、优化数据库性能、监控数据库的使用情况等。

    以上是一个简单的数据库操作流程,实际使用中可能会更加复杂。为了更好地使用数据库,我们可以学习和掌握数据库管理系统的基本知识和技巧,以及相应的SQL语言和工具。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部